The AEDP Tetrapeptide
Cortagen is a synthetic tetrapeptide consisting of four amino acids: alanine, glutamic acid, aspartic acid, and proline — the sequence Ala‑Glu‑Asp‑Pro (AEDP). Its molecular formula is C₁₇H₂₆N₄O₉, and its molecular weight is approximately 430.17‑430.41 g/mol. The peptide belongs to the Khavinson family of short peptide bioregulators — molecules hypothesised to penetrate cells, reach the nucleus, and interact with DNA and chromatin to modulate gene expression in a tissue‑specific manner.
Mechanism of Action: Epigenetic Modulation and Chromatin Remodelling
The biological activity of Cortagen (20mg) research peptide is thought to be mediated through epigenetic interactions with chromatin:
Chromatin Decondensation (Deheterochromatinisation)
Research by Lezhava et al. has demonstrated that Cortagen induces unrolling deheterochromatinisation (decondensation) of total heterochromatin in aged cell cultures. This process involves the partial unfolding of higher‑order chromatin structures, such as 30‑nm fibres, into more relaxed conformations, potentially making previously repressed genes more accessible for transcription. Importantly, this effect is selective — Cortagen causes deheterochromatinisation of facultative heterochromatin while preserving the structural integrity of pericentromeric heterochromatin.
Activation of Ribosomal Genes and Protein Synthesis
Following chromatin decondensation, ribosomal gene clusters become more transcriptionally active, as evidenced by increased synthetic processes of ribosomal genes. This activation may support protein synthesis capacity, particularly relevant in aged cells where the ability to synthesise proteins often declines.
Gene Expression Modulation
Microarray analysis has revealed that Cortagen significantly alters gene expression in the mouse heart, with both common and specific effects on gene expression. It has also been shown to modulate the expression of IL‑2 mRNA in hypothalamic structures and stimulate the growth of explants from the brain cortex and subcortical structures.
Reduction of Oxidative Stress
Cortagen decreases the content of lipid peroxidation products and reduces oxidative modification of proteins in the cerebral cortex. This suggests a role in modulating oxidative stress and maintaining cellular redox balance.

2. Neuroprotection & Nerve Regeneration Research
Cortagen has demonstrated pronounced effects on the structural and functional posttraumatic recovery of peripheral nerve tissue. Research applications include:
-
Nerve Regeneration Studies: Cortagen increased the length of the nerve segment able to conduct impulses by 27% and improved conduction velocity by 40% compared to placebo
-
Neuroprotection: Cortagen activates neurons and maintains antioxidant activity in brain tissues
-
Cerebral Ischemia Models: Studies show Cortagen accelerated behavioural recovery following cerebral ischemia
-
Neurodegenerative Models: Cortagen has demonstrated therapeutic activity in Drosophila models for neurodegenerative disorders
-
Peripheral Nerve Injury: Research on the delayed effect of cortagen on the restoration of injured nerve function is documented in PubMed
